What Exactly is a Curved Metal Pipe?

At its core, a curved metal pipe is a tube made usually from steel, stainless steel, or sometimes special alloys that’s been bent or rolled into a smooth curve. This differs from elbow joints which are separate components welded to straight pipes; curved pipes are shaped in a factory or through onsite bending technologies, offering a continuous, seamless form.

This continuity translates into fewer leak points, higher pressure tolerances, and improved flow dynamics, all critical in industries like oil transport, water management, and even HVAC systems.

Key Factors Behind Curved Metal Pipe Performance

1. Durability & Material Strength

Curved metal pipes often use carbon steel for strength or stainless steel for corrosion resistance, depending on the application. The bending process must ensure no micro-cracks or weakening happens, something many manufacturers verify through ultrasonic testing.

2. Precision Bending Techniques

From rotary draw bending to induction bending and mandrel bending, the shape quality affects stress distribution. Mandrel bending, for example, allows for tight curves without wrinkling or ovality—highly prized in high-pressure pipelines.

3. Cost Efficiency

It might surprise you, but curved pipes can reduce installation costs by minimizing the need for multiple elbows or joints, which require welding and inspection. Less labor, fewer parts, and faster assembly — savings add up.

4. Versatility & Customization

Available in a variety of diameters, thicknesses, and radii, curved metal pipes cater to nuanced needs. Often, suppliers offer bespoke solutions for sectors as varied as food processing, chemical plants, and municipal water systems.

5. Safety & Compliance

Meeting ISO 9001 quality standards, as well as regional safety codes like ASME B31.3 or EN 10253, ensures these pipes withstand operational rigors responsibly.

Curved Metal Pipe Specification Overview

Specification Typical Values Notes
Material Carbon Steel, Stainless Steel, Alloy Steel Depends on corrosion & pressure requirements
Diameter Range 20 mm to 2000 mm Customized per project
Bending Radius 1.5x to 6x pipe diameter Varies by bending method
Pressure Rating 150 psi to 3000 psi Highly dependent on material and wall thickness
Testing Ultrasonic, Radiographic, Hydrostatic Ensures weld & integrity quality

Challenges & Solutions in Today’s Curved Pipe Landscape

One common challenge is the risk of pipe ovality—where the cross-section deforms during bending, which can weaken the structure. Fixes include mandrel bending and computer-controlled bend profiling, but these need highly skilled operators.

Another issue is handling customized orders for remote sites quickly. Companies are investing in modular bends and onsite bend fabrication units to cut lead times. It’s a bit like bringing part of the factory to the job itself.

FAQ: Your Questions About Curved Metal Pipe, Answered

  • Q: How does a curved metal pipe differ from a pipe elbow?
    A: A curved metal pipe is bent into shape as a continuous piece, reducing welds and potential leak points, whereas pipe elbows are separate fittings welded to straight pipes.
  • Q: What industries most benefit from curved metal pipes?
    A: Oil and gas, water treatment, chemical manufacturing, HVAC, and infrastructure projects heavily rely on curved pipes for complex routing and safety.
  • Q: Can curved metal pipes be recycled?
    A: Yes, most are made of steel alloys that are highly recyclable, supporting environmental sustainability goals.

  • Reducer

    Reducer

    Reducer is a pipe fitting used to connect pipes of different diameters, facilitating smooth transitions between varying flow capacities in piping systems. Available in concentric and eccentric designs, reducers help maintain optimal flow efficiency while minimizing pressure loss and turbulence.
